Board logo

Subject: 最新版,CNBITBTN中出现的问题? [Print This Page]

Author: 我本无名    Time: 2008-7-18 21:18     Subject: 最新版,CNBITBTN中出现的问题?

一个简单窗口,需要“增加”“删除”“修改“等功能,窗口上有一个”过滤“控件cnbitbtn1(运行过程就是根据条件重新打开数据表),运行一遍后,其它的cnbitbtn控件,好像刷新,但不自动显示,光标移到其它的cnbitbtn控件,才显示出来。“增加”“删除”“修改“这几个功能完成后自动显示,不出现上面的情况。
CNBITBTN我改了几个参数:
btncolorstyle :bcsChrome
modernbtnstyle :bsModern
Author: 我本无名    Time: 2008-7-19 06:59

再说明一下,我的窗体是:MDI,改成:stayontop,没有以上现象。
问题二:无论是什么窗体格式,cnbitbtn的“删除”用delete
和deleterecords(arCurrent),运行后删除成功,但关闭窗体????
问题三:“增加”运行后,我用的CNEDIT控件,列表用EHDBGRID,
“保存”列表中不显示(列表中一条记录也不显示),退出后重新进入就显示?
Author: Passion    Time: 2008-7-19 09:55

好的感谢反馈,让作者巴哈帮看看。
不过第二个问题,貌似不是按钮的问题吧?你试一试把delete或deleterecords(arCurrent)放其他菜单项或其他Button中执行,看看是否也出错?
Author: 我本无名    Time: 2008-7-19 19:25

刘工,按你的提示,重新加了一个bitbtn,删除没有问题的。
Author: 我本无名    Time: 2008-7-19 19:27

可能就是按钮的问题,让作者看一下
Author: Passion    Time: 2008-7-19 23:28

在MDIForm的背景下,改变MDIForm的尺寸时,确实会发生CnButton隐藏掉的情况,我们会继续检查的。
Author: Passion    Time: 2008-7-25 17:52

后来做了些修改。MDI窗体的问题应该已经修复了。烦请从CVS上倒过最新代码来验证一下?




Welcome to CnPack Forum (http://bbs.cnpack.org/) Powered by Discuz! 5.0.0